Sword Art Online: Hollow Fragment is a Role Playing Game (RPG) based on the novel, manga and anime, Sword Art Online, and reflects the charming characters and breathtaking environments from the virtual reality world called Aincrad. In a simulated Massively Multiplayer Online Role Playing Game (MMORPG) setting, players find that they are trapped within the game and must explore and defeat enemies until they reach the highest levels of Aincrad to beat the game and free themselves from the fantasy world. BEN-TO Every day, an epic struggle rages in grocery stores across Japan - the battle for half-priced bento boxes! Once the discount stickers go on, ravenous brawlers start throwing punches in a knockdown, drag-out war over who gets to take home the cheap eats. When a young, broke high school student named Sato joins the ‘Half-Priced Food Lovers Club’, he proves to be a rising talent in the world of insane food fights. But does he have what it takes to become the king of clearance cuisine? From the director of BLACK CAT comes a very different type of hunger games. Before reading on, don't forget to have a look at our review of volumes 1 and 2 of Sword Art Online .  Sword Art Online Volumes 3 and 4 encompass the second arc of the series seeing Kirito released from the cyber-prison that is Sword Art Online. Unfortunately, not everyone shares his fate. Still stuck in an RPG induced coma is his new love, the hot headed Asuna. So, of course like any good hero, he dives straight back in to save his fair maiden. Welcome to the world of ALfheim Online, the land of fairies and spiritual successor to the much maligned and seriously deadly Sword Art Online. The first thing that strikes you about Sword Art Online on Blu Ray is the gorgeous animation. Not only are the colours vibrant and vivid, but the line work is super crisp and pops off the screen. Sword Art Online, SAO for short, is something of a phenomenon. Following its inception in 2009 as a light novel series, it has spawned manga releases, a swathe of merchandise, an anime series and even an art exhibition which is being brought to Australia by Madman. But does this necessarily mean that the anime series will be good? Thankfully in this case, yes it does. Set in the near future, Sword Art Online is a MMORPG with a twist. Instead of being played with a keyboard and mouse it uses a virtual reality helmet which effectively connects the player with the game directly. In a cruel twist of human induced fate, players find themselves stuck in the game with the threat that if they die in the game world, so too will there mind in the real world unless the final level is cleared. Usually when events such as these are announced they're met by a song of "what about Queensland?" or "Perth never gets anything!" but this time SYDNEY misses out. Granted, so do a couple of other states as well but this is still a fantastic opportunity for QLD, WA and VIC otaku to get their fill at the Sword Art Online 2014 Exhibition Tour. Following on from the hugely successful Evangelion exhibition, Madman are delivering Sword Art Online to our shores with art, storyboards, character designs, photo opportunities and MERCH available at each event.
